2012-10-24 60 views
-4

我是Asp.net應用程序中安全性的新手。我想在我開發的asp.net本地應用程序中啓用SSL。我需要一步一步的執行ssl到我的asp.net項目。我在網上找到的大多數文章只解釋了證書的安裝。作爲新手,我會做的第一件事情就是將我的http轉換爲https。我需要更改web.config中的任何內容嗎?如何在ASP.NET C#應用程序中使用SSL

+0

什麼是IIS版本?自簽名證書? –

+0

我已經從startssl獲得免費證書只需要測試實現 – JED

回答

0

首先,您必須購買SSL證書。這不是免費的。

然後,您需要在本地IIS上託管。如果您在Windows上運行,則可以在「程序和功能」中激活它。然後你可以在那裏安裝SSL證書(你可以在IIS管理器中找到一個圖標)。

我想你在Visual Studio中運行網站,並且在IIS上託管網站是完全不同的。如果您沒有這方面的經驗,我會建議您開始使用,或者查看您是否可以避免使用SSL證書。

+0

這是否意味着我的項目必須在IIS中運行,其中文件位於wwwrooot文件夾中,而不是在我的VS Project文件夾中創建的普通項目。 – JED

+0

進行部署,是的。在本地你可以使用iss express:http://www.hanselman.com/blog/WorkingWithSSLAtDevelopmentTimeIsEasierWithIISExpress.aspx –

+0

@JPHellemons謝謝 – JED

相關問題